The MAX9692EPE+ works on the fundamental premise of a voltage comparator. This type of circuit compares two voltages, and signals if one of the voltages is larger. When the output of the circuit is “high,” this denotes that the first voltage is larger than the second; conversely, when the output of the circuit is “low,” this denotes the second voltage is larger than the first.
